Abstract

This use case applies KRYOS-XS to travel preparation and return-stage security. The objective is a proportionate security profile based on role, data exposure and mission need rather than a uniform restriction for every traveler.

Decision problem

Travel controls can fail in two directions. Weak preparation exposes accounts and sensitive information. Excessive restriction prevents staff from performing the work that justified travel. The decision must establish which assets and privileges are necessary, which should be removed temporarily and what review is required after return.

Evidence and Hypercube reasoning

Console considers the traveler’s role, destination, devices, accessible accounts, sensitive files, partner requirements and approved organizational guidance. Hypercube compares alternative travel profiles and estimates consequence under plausible coercion, loss and compromise scenarios.

Governed workflow

Before departure, KRYOS recommends a travel configuration and identifies required approval. During travel, defined events can trigger reassessment. After return, Console guides credential rotation, temporary-access closure and device review. Each stage becomes part of one continuous decision record.

Evaluation design

The pilot should measure sensitive data removed, temporary permissions closed, post-travel reviews completed, security exceptions, operational disruption and cases in which the recommended profile changed after better information became available.

Boundary condition

Travel risk judgments should be tied to documented organizational sources and current operational information, not stereotypes about a location.
